开通会员
  • 尊享所有功能
  • 文件大小最高200M
  • 文件无水印
  • 尊贵VIP身份
  • VIP专属服务
  • 历史记录保存30天云存储
开通会员
您的位置:首页 > 帮助中心 > python 识别pdf文字_利用Python识别PDF文字的探索
默认会员免费送
帮助中心 >

python 识别pdf文字_利用Python识别PDF文字的探索

2024-12-24 18:01:16
python 识别pdf文字_利用python识别pdf文字的探索
《python识别pdf文字》

在当今数字化时代,python为识别pdf文字提供了高效的解决方案。首先,我们可以使用pypdf2库来处理pdf文件,但它主要是对pdf结构进行操作,识别文字需借助其他工具。

tesseract - ocr引擎结合python的pytesseract库是个不错的选择。要先安装tesseract软件并配置好环境变量。使用pytesseract时,通过python代码打开pdf文件并将每页转换为图像格式,再利用pytesseract将图像中的文字识别出来。

另外,pdfminer.six库也能胜任。它可以解析pdf文档,从中提取文本内容,对于一些结构较为简单的pdf文件,能快速准确地识别出其中文字。这些方法使得python在处理pdf文字识别相关任务时表现出色,广泛应用于文档处理、数据挖掘等领域。

python读取pdf内容转word

python读取pdf内容转word
《python实现pdf内容读取转word》

在数据处理中,有时需要将pdf内容转换为word格式。python提供了有效的解决方案。

首先,我们可以使用pypdf2库来读取pdf文件内容。通过简单的代码打开pdf文件,获取其中的文本信息。然而,pypdf2在处理复杂排版的pdf时可能存在一些局限。

接着,借助python - docx库来创建word文档。将从pdf中提取的文本按照需求的格式写入word文档。虽然这个过程可能无法完全精准还原pdf的所有样式,但能够满足基本的文本转换需求。这一操作流程在文档格式转换、数据迁移等场景中有着重要意义,为用户提供了便捷的自动化转换方式。

python如何读取pdf文字

python如何读取pdf文字
《python读取pdf文字的方法》

在python中,我们可以借助第三方库来读取pdf中的文字。其中,pypdf2是常用的库。

首先,要安装pypdf2库。然后通过以下简单步骤读取文字:

```python
import pypdf2

# 打开pdf文件
with open('example.pdf', 'rb') as file:
reader = pypdf2.pdffilereader(file)
num_pages = reader.numpages

for page_num in range(num_pages):
page = reader.getpage(page_num)
text = page.extracttext()
print(text)


```

不过,pypdf2可能在某些复杂排版的pdf上提取文字效果不太理想。另一个库pdfplumber则更强大些,它可以更好地处理表格和复杂布局的pdf文字提取。通过类似的步骤导入库并操作,就能获取到pdf中的文字内容,这在文档处理、数据挖掘等方面非常有用。

python读取pdf文档

python读取pdf文档
python读取pdf文档

在数据处理和信息提取工作中,python读取pdf文档是一项非常实用的技能。python有多个库可用于读取pdf,其中pypdf2较为常用。

首先,需安装pypdf2库。使用时,通过简单的代码就能打开pdf文件。例如,利用`pdffilereader`类来读取pdf的元数据,如文档的作者、标题等信息。若要读取pdf中的文本内容,虽然pypdf2有一定局限性,但仍可获取页面中的部分文本。对于一些格式简单的pdf,能够较为顺利地将文本提取出来,然后可进一步进行分析、处理或者存储到其他格式中,这为自动化文档处理等工作提供了极大的便利。
您已连续签到 0 天,当前积分:0
  • 第1天
    积分+10
  • 第2天
    积分+10
  • 第3天
    积分+10
  • 第4天
    积分+10
  • 第5天
    积分+10
  • 第6天
    积分+10
  • 第7天

    连续签到7天

    获得积分+10

获得10积分

明天签到可得10积分

咨询客服

扫描二维码,添加客服微信